Jimmi Langemo of the Band of Souls will perform 6:30 – 10 p.m. on Aug. 10 at the GunFlint Tavern in Grand Marais along with his bass player, Nate.
The Minneapolis band is a blues, roots and old school R&B band. Last January, the band represented Minnesota in the International Blues Challenge in Memphis, Tennessee, where over 150 bands from around the world competed. “We earned our way to the semi-finals. It was quite an honor,” said Langemo.
The band’s fifth album, The Graveyard Shift, will be coming out later this fall.
Of the Grand Marais appearance, Langemo said, “It’s right in the middle of a northern Minnesota/ Wisconsin tour. Before our date in Grand Marais, we play in Menahga, Alexandria, and at the Bayfront Blues Fest in Duluth. After our gig in Grand Marais, we play two dates in Ely (including the Boundary Waters Blues Fest) and two dates in Wausau, including the Big Bull Falls Blues Fest.”
“We love Grand Marais! Playing in your town has been one of our goals since we started the band,” said Langemo.
